WebYamuna River. The Yamuna (Sanskrit: यमुना), sometimes called Jamuna (Bengali: যমুনা, Hindi: जमुना, Urdu: جمنا) or Jumna, is the largest tributary river of theGanges (Ganga) in northern India. Originating from the Yamunotri Glacier at a height of 6,387 metres on the south western slopes of Banderpooch peaks in ... The atmosphere along the river bank is full of peace and spirituality along with our migratory winter guests, Siberian gulls, covering the whole sky. pros and cons of housing developmentsWebThe capital city of Delhi is the largest polluter of Yamuna. The city is the largest consumer of water, with a production of 2,728 mid of treated water. Though the length and basin area of the river in Delhi is barely 2 percent, it contributes 71 percent of the waste water and 55 per cent of the total BOD load discharged into the river every day. research2businessWebAug 6, 2013 · M ost people will agree that the river bodies of India like the Ganga and Yamuna are today a shrunken image of their past glory.
